## Authentication

Heads up: the nightly reindex job (`reindex_nightly.py`) talks to the Lanternfish search cluster, and that cluster won't accept anonymous writes anymore — we locked it down last sprint. The job now authenticates as the `reindex-runner` service identity against Corvid Gateway, and the token is injected via the `LF_INDEX_TOKEN` env var in the scheduler config. Nothing clever going on, just a bearer header on every batch request. For review purposes, the staging credential currently in use is listed below.

service key, kadug-kadup: kto15_rN23XLAYImmZgrJ

## Deploying the Gatewick Proctor Queue

Deploys are pretty painless: push to main, wait for the pipeline, then watch the queue drain dashboard for five minutes. If candidates pile up mid-exam, roll back first and ask questions later — the queue replays safely. Everything the workers care about lives in one config block, shown here for reference.

settings of bafof-yagef:
JOROX_PIN=8740
JOROX_TENANT=pelox
JOROX_METRICS_HOST=metrics.jorox.qorvelworks.internal
JOROX_SEAL=seal_c78f63c1
JOROX_STANDBY_TEAM=norax

The Pixelgrove snapshot testing suite compares rendered UI components against golden images stored in our internal artifact service, Lockbin. Before running `pixsnap update`, you must authenticate, otherwise uploads of new baselines will silently fail and your diffs will look stale. Authentication uses a single internal API key scoped to the snapshot bucket; contractors receive a short-lived key that rotates every two weeks. Export it in your shell profile before your first run. The current key for your environment appears directly below.

app token of yajeg-kawef = kto11_7En3XSX8xQw

Ticket: Matchbridge prod config drift — GC pauses back

Hey Solene — prod-east is pausing for 800ms again during peak matching, and staging isn't. Looks like someone hand-edited the heap settings on prod-east after the Kelgrave incident and never synced it back. Can we lock this down before Thursday's release? For reference, staging currently runs with these values.

deployment values, kajep-kageg:
[praix]
host = praix.paliqcorp.corp
user = praix_svc
database = praix_prod